WR10 house prices

The typical home in postcode district WR10 last sold for £210,000, based on the official HM Land Registry record. Over the past decade prices are +38% in cash — but −1% once inflation is stripped out.

WR10 house prices — your questions

What is the average house price in WR10?

Half of homes sold in WR10 went for more than £210,000 and half for less, across 9,667 sales.

What is the price range of homes sold in WR10?

Recorded sales in WR10 range from £14,000 to £3,161,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.

Have house prices in WR10 risen?

Over the past decade prices in WR10 are +38% in cash terms but −1%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.

How much is a house per square metre in WR10?

In WR10 the median price is £2,338 per square metre, from 3,121 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.

How up to date is this data?

H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in WR10 was 7 May 2026.
